Sustainability Efforts
HP has made significant strides in reducing its environmental footprint through various sustainability initiatives. The company has set ambitious goals to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, conserve water, and minimize waste across its operations. Some notable sustainability efforts include:
HP’s commitment to using renewable energy sources, such as wind and solar power, to power its facilities. The company has set a goal to power 100% of its operations with renewable energy by 2025.
The implementation of energy-efficient technologies in its products and operations, such as LED lighting and energy-efficient servers.
The development of sustainable packaging solutions, including the use of recyclable materials and minimal packaging design.

How does HP support education and digital literacy in underserved communities?
HP has launched several initiatives to support education and digital literacy in underserved communities. The company has developed programs to provide access to technology, digital skills training, and educational resources to disadvantaged communities. For example, HP has partnered with organizations such as the Boys and Girls Clubs of America and the National Urban League to provide technology and digital skills training to young people. The company has also launched initiatives to support education and digital literacy in developing countries, such as its World on Wheels program, which provides mobile computer labs and digital skills training to rural communities.
HP’s support for education and digital literacy is critical to bridging the digital divide and promoting social mobility. The company’s initiatives aim to provide individuals with the skills and knowledge they need to succeed in the digital economy. How does HP measure and report its sustainability and social responsibility performance?
HP measures and reports its sustainability and social responsibility performance through a comprehensive framework that includes key performance indicators (KPIs) and metrics. The company tracks its progress against its sustainability and social responsibility targets, such as reducing greenhouse gas emissions, waste, and water usage, and promoting diversity and inclusion. HP also conducts regular audits and assessments to ensure the accuracy and transparency of its sustainability and social responsibility reporting. The company publishes an annual Sustainability Report that provides a detailed account of its sustainability and social responsibility performance, including its progress against its targets and goals.
HP’s sustainability and social responsibility reporting is guided by international standards and frameworks, such as the Global Reporting Initiative (GRI) and the Sustainability Accounting Standards Board (SASB).
